Yolanda is a female given name from western europe and north america, derived from the greek name iolanthe meaning violet (the flower) Derived from the spanish word yolanda, meaning violet flower, this name carries a rich history that has left an indelible mark throughout the ages. In german and dutch the name is spoken similarly but traditionally spelled jolanda, and in italian, portuguese and romanian iolanda.

The name yolanda is a girl's name of spanish, greek origin meaning violet flower

Bold and distinctive, yolanda is a floral name that doesn't sound frilly or delicate. Yolanda is a beautiful name of spanish origin that carries a rich and symbolic meaning This feminine name is often associated with the image of a delicate yet strong violet flower, which reflects qualities of beauty, resilience, and grace. Etymologically linked to the medieval french yolande, itself a vernacular rendering of the greek compound iolanthe (“ion” — violet + “anthos” — flower), yolanda conveys a botanical nuance of regal restraint rather than overt sentimentality.

The name yolanda has its origins in greek and is derived from the word iole, meaning violet. it has been used in various cultures, including spanish and italian, often maintaining its original form. Yolanda is a name with a rich history and a strong, elegant feel Of greek origin, it carries the meaning 'violet flower,' evoking images of beauty and grace Primarily used as a feminine name, yolanda has a timeless appeal and a classic sound that remains popular across generations.
